Transaction f383154731f2e86431c4d03481fb034783d68df33c986a3e0e2f559bfaf5070f

block
47e58657f109a3c5b1bc25079f1ddca4e27cccfb7db79aa55c0bee1f2688eb2b

1 Input

23 Outputs